Removido o Python 3 e agora o Ubuntu Software Center, o terminal e outros aplicativos não funcionam

15

Eu sou um novo usuário do Ubuntu executando o Ubuntu 13.04.

Eu tenho tentado instalar e usar uma ferramenta DeDRM, mas estou tendo problemas para fazê-lo. Eu estava seguindo algumas instruções que diziam que precisava de uma versão do Python 2.7, mas não de nada do Python 3.0 ou posterior (porque faltam algumas bibliotecas necessárias nas versões 3.0). Tentei instalar o Python 2.7.5.6, mas não funcionou. Eu pensei que era provavelmente porque eu tinha a versão mais recente do Python, então passei pelo terminal e removi o Python 3.3, para poder instalar a versão anterior do Python.

Agora que desinstalei o Python 3.3, muitos aplicativos não funcionam mais, incluindo o terminal e o Ubuntu Software Center. Não tenho idéia de como resolver esse problema agora.

Frida
fonte
Eu pressiono Ctrl + Alt + F1 você ainda tem um terminal? Pressione Ctrl + Alt + F7 para voltar à área de trabalho.
Paul Tanzini
É realmente chamado de VC (Virtual Console). Por favor, siga uma das respostas dadas aqui. Uma instalação padrão do Ubuntu fornecerá a última versão (estável) do Python2 e Python3 --- eles são fundamentais para que o Ubuntu funcione, então você realmente precisa deles. Observe que você pode precisar reinstalar mais software, como software ... Eu aconselho a reinstalar pelo menos o ubuntu-desktop.
Rmano
o seu problema foi resolvido ??
Sukupa91

Respostas:

16
  1. Abra um console virtual somente de texto pressionando o atalho do teclado Ctrl+ Alt+ F3.

  2. No login:prompt, digite seu nome de usuário e pressione Enter.

  3. No Password:prompt, digite sua senha de usuário e pressione Enter.

  4. Reinstale a versão padrão do Python 3 executando o seguinte comando:

    sudo apt-get install python3-all
  5. Saia do console virtual e retorne ao seu ambiente de área de trabalho pressionando o atalho do teclado Ctrl+ Alt+ F7. No Ubuntu 17.10 e posterior, pressione o atalho do teclado Ctrl+ Alt+ F2para sair do console virtual.


Depois de instalar a versão padrão do Python 3, você precisa recuperar seu sistema de desktop Ubuntu padrão. Para evitar estragar algo, faça-o na seguinte ordem:

  1. Primeiro instale o terminal a partir do console usando o comando: sudo apt-get install gnome-terminal. Se você não conseguir instalar o gnome-terminal, pule esta etapa e vá para a etapa 2.

  2. Volte à sua área de trabalho e abra o terminal usando o atalho de teclado Ctrl+ Alt+ T. No terminal, instale o Ubuntu Software Center usando o comando:

    sudo apt-get install software-center

    No Ubuntu 16.04 e posterior, execute este comando para reinstalar o aplicativo de software padrão:

    sudo apt-get install gnome-software

    Se você ainda não conseguir abrir o terminal, execute o mesmo comando no console. Se você não conseguir instalar o aplicativo de software padrão, pule esta etapa e vá para a etapa 3.

  3. Abra o terminal e tente abrir o Ubuntu Software Center a partir do terminal executando o comando apropriado, software-centerou gnome-software. Desde o Ubuntu Software Center instalar o sistema desktop Ubuntu ou então abrir o terminal (ou o console) e instalar o sistema desktop Ubuntu executando o comando: sudo apt-get install ubuntu-desktop.

karel
fonte
Isso reinstalará o python, mas não automaticamente todo o software que o acompanha. Talvez a reinstalação do ubuntu-desktop reinstale de volta a maior parte do necessário para ter um sistema em funcionamento.
Rmano
Estou esperando para ver como isso acontece. Eu começaria com os pacotes gnome-terminal e software-center, se ainda não estiverem lá. Sua sugestão para instalar o ubuntu-desktop faz muito sentido para mim, mas ainda estou preocupado com a possibilidade de alterar os ícones padrão da área de trabalho e também a interface do usuário do método de entrada IBus. Esse pode ser um problema dolorosamente difícil de reparar e, portanto, não quero dizer ao Frida para reinstalar o ubuntu-desktop, exceto como último recurso. Pingue-me do chat Pergunte ao Ubuntu General Room sempre que quiser falar mais sobre isso ou sobre o assunto do Python 2 / Python 3.
Karel
1
edite de 18 de abril de 2019 a 18.04 e, agora, você precisa pressionar Ctrl + Alt + F1 para retornar ao Ubuntu Desktop. também sim; você realmente precisa reinstalar o ubuntu-desktop ainda para que ele possa "reconstruir" tudo; mas tudo continuará funcionando e perfeitamente bem quando você terminar. Aprendi isso da maneira mais difícil, é claro.
EarthToAccess 18/04/19
@EarthToAccess Observei essa atualização do console hoje quando atualizei meu software usando o Atualizador de Software, mas meu Ubuntu 18.04 ainda usa Ctrl + Alt + F7 para retornar à área de trabalho. Vou tentar novamente depois de reiniciar e ver se Ctrl + Alt + F1 também funciona por causa da atualização.
Karel
5

Para corrigir os problemas do seu sistema, você só precisa reinstalar o python 3.3.

Se você executou, por exemplo: sudo apt-get remove python3

Você pode revertê-lo executando: sudo apt-get install python3

Claro que este é um comando do terminal e, como você disse que o Terminal não está funcionando, isso é um problema. Você pode usar o TTY1 para efetuar login e executar este comando pressionando Ctrl + Alt + F1. Para retornar à área de trabalho normal, pressione Ctrl + Alt + F7.

Paul Tanzini
fonte
4

Isto é o que eu fiz:

Pressione Ctrl+ Alt+ F1e faça o login.

Execute este comando:

sudo apt-get remove python/python3

Reiniciar

Pressione Ctrl+ Alt+ F1e faça o login.

Execute estes comandos:

sudo apt-get install python3
sudo apt-get install python
sudo apt-get install ubuntu-desktop

Reiniciar

Feito!

user244829
fonte
2
sudo apt-get install software-center

isso vai ajudar definitivamente.

Em seguida, no centro de software, você pode instalar o terminal e assim por diante.

Raj
fonte